I lived in Boston for many years in the late 1990s and early 2000s. I loved the city and the people I connected to there. One of the best connections I made was with a community activist and organizer who was working on the Main Streets program in the neighborhood where I lived. While I have not kept in touch with her as much as I would have liked through my moves around the country and world, Jennifer Rose has inspired me in many ways.

Jennifer was a networker; she made connections in a way that I admired. Now with all the social media we have, staying connected to people you meet is not as hard, but in the late nineties, it took a lot of work, and Jennifer was a wiz. She remembered everyone’s names and was able to connect people in her network with ease. I admired this skill, have tried to emulate it in my own life, but have come up short. I am bad with names and am poor at keeping up the connections I make, even with social media.

Jennifer also invited me to an event that she hosted annually, an International Women’s Day Tea. While I only attended once, I have been always wanted to start a similar tradition. Jennifer hosted women from her network in her home where she served snacks and tea. The diversity of women I met that day was wonderful and a true celebration.

Since this tea party, I have tried on a few occasions to do a similar event, with mixed success. And this year, with Covid, there is no tea party planned. But my hope is that starting next year, I am able to emulate the event that Jennifer had by inviting women to my home to celebrate their day.

Jennifer has been recognized for the work she has done in Waltham MA and today I want to recognize her for the impact she had on me in the short time we connected. I can only hope that I can contribute even a fraction of what Jennifer has done in her community in mine. As I look to the work I want to accomplish this next year, I will keep inspiring women like Jennifer in my mind.
